Vegetarian Chili

2 tbsp oil
1 Medium Onion, chopped
1/2 cup chopped celery
2 garlic cloves, crushed
1 16 oz Petite Diced Hunts Tomatoes, undrained
1 8 oz can tomato sauce
1 15 oz Dark Red Kidney Beans, rinsed, drained
1 15 oz can Butter Beans, rinsed, drained
1 15 oz can Black Beans, rinsed, drained
1 15 oz can Garbanzo beans, rinsed, drained
1 11 oz can whole kernel golden sweet corn
1 8 oz can mushrooms pieces and stems, drained
1-2 tbsp chili powder
1-2 tsp cumin
1/2 tsp dried cumin leaves
2-3 whole bay leaves

Heat oil in a large pot and add onion, celery and garlic, cook 4-6 minutes or until tender
Add remaining ingredients, bring to a boil, reduce heat to medium and cook 20-30 minutes, until thoroughly heated and flavors are blended (I also have been known to add in other spices, most recently a bit of cinnamon to the chili...mmmm...)

You can garnish with avocado, cheese or sour cream

Serve with cornbread, crackers, whatever you have on hand
